随笔分类 -  asp.net

摘要:转载 https://www.cnblogs.com/yuangang/p/5464758.html 简述 Razor是ASP.NET MVC 3中新加入的技术,以作为ASPX引擎的一个新的替代项。在早期的MVC版本中默认使用的是ASPX模板引擎,Razor在语法上的确不错,用起来非常方便,简洁的语 阅读全文
posted @ 2018-06-05 14:14 枫- 阅读(307) 评论(0) 推荐(0)
摘要:“/”应用程序中的服务器错误。 编译错误 说明: 在编译向该请求提供服务所需资源的过程中出现错误。请检查下列特定错误详细信息并适当地修改源代码。 编译器错误消息: CS1704: 已经导入了具有相同的简单名称“Ray.Core, Version=1.0.0.0, Culture=neutral, P 阅读全文
posted @ 2017-05-11 19:08 枫- 阅读(451) 评论(0) 推荐(0)
摘要:Redis简介 Redis是一个开源的,使用C语言编写,面向“键/值”对类型数据的分布式NoSQL数据库系统,特点是高性能,持久存储,适应高并发的应用场景。Redis纯粹为应用而产生,它是一个高性能的key-value数据库,并且提供了多种语言的API 性能测试结果表示SET操作每秒钟可达11000 阅读全文
posted @ 2016-06-14 15:56 枫- 阅读(375) 评论(0) 推荐(0)
摘要:一、IIS:应用程序池队列(Application pool queue,位于HTTP.SYS)这是请求到达IIS后遇到的第一个队列,http.sys收到请求后会将请求放入对应的应用程序池队列,这样可以减少上下文的切换。需要注意的是应用程序池队列虽然是给w3wp进程用的,但它存在于http.sys的... 阅读全文
posted @ 2015-10-22 17:17 枫- 阅读(836) 评论(0) 推荐(0)
摘要:1、(maxWorkerThreads * CPU逻辑数量)-minFreeThreads比如2个CPU默认配置maxWorkerThreads=100,minFreeThreads=176,则同时最大只能有24个工作线程。(这里不管 这个配置的值,经过测试,不管这里的maxconnection为多少,最终都是从上面的计算公式计算出来的)2、maxconnection,这个值是每秒可以支持的线程数。(但实际每秒可以并行运行的线程为(maxWorkerThreads * CPU逻辑数量)-minFreeThreads的结果),一般要求支持并发量,每个并发请求都很耗时的情况下,就需要设置该值... 阅读全文
posted @ 2013-08-30 17:00 枫- 阅读(479) 评论(0) 推荐(0)
摘要:百度地址创建工具:http://dev.baidu.com/wiki/static/map/API/tool/creatMap/<!doctype html><html><head> <meta charset="utf-8"> <meta content="," name="keywords"> <meta content="," name="description"> <meta http-equiv=" 阅读全文
posted @ 2012-10-26 17:00 枫- 阅读(258) 评论(0) 推荐(0)
摘要:Asp.NET有许多秘密,当你了解了这些秘密后,可以使得你的ASP.NET应用程序达到极大的性能提升。举例来说,在使用Membership 和profile进行Authentication和authorization时,可以通过简单的修改Membership和profile以提高 Authentication和authorization的性能;ASP.NET Http 管道通过调整以避免执行不必要的HttpModules;不仅如此,浏览器端的页面缓存可以为重复浏览节省大量的下载时间;按需UI加载可以使网站更快、 更平滑;最后,t适当的应用CDN(Cotent Delivery Networks 阅读全文
posted @ 2012-10-20 19:46 枫- 阅读(324) 评论(0) 推荐(0)
摘要:namespace SampleListT{ class Program { static void Main(string[] args) { //using System.Collections.Generic; 命名空间中的List<T> //using System.Collections; 命名空间中的ArrayList //都实现了列表集合,一个是泛形集合,一个是非泛型的 //下面我们将Person对象加到集合中 Person p1 = new Person( "aladdin" , 20 ); Person p2 = ne... 阅读全文
posted @ 2012-08-21 17:36 枫- 阅读(1108) 评论(0) 推荐(1)
摘要:近日调试一Asp.net程序,出现了“访问 IIS 元数据库失败”的错误信息,最后经过搜索发现了解决问题的方法。解决方法如下: 1、依次点击“开始”-“运行”。 2、在“运行”栏内输入 “C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e -i ”(不含引号),然后点“确定”按钮。 3、出现的cmd窗口中显示“开始安装ASP.NET XXX”等内容,等待这个窗口自动关闭。 好了,到这里一般问题就解决了,如果尚未解决请参考下面的文章。来源:互联网。 -------------------... 阅读全文
posted @ 2012-03-02 09:21 枫- 阅读(151) 评论(0) 推荐(0)
摘要:C#格式化数值结果表字符说明示例输出C货币string.Format("{0:C3}", 2)$2.000D十进制string.Format("{0:D3}", 2)002E科学计数法1.20E+0011.20E+001G常规string.Format("{0:G}", 2)2N用分号隔开的数字string.Format("{0:N}", 250000)250,000.00X十六进制string.Format("{0:X000}", 12)Cstring.Format("{0:000. 阅读全文
posted @ 2012-01-04 18:50 枫- 阅读(191) 评论(0) 推荐(0)
摘要:using System;using System.Collections.Generic;using System.Text;using System.Drawing;using System.Net;using System.Web;using HtmlAgilityPack;using System.Text.RegularExpressions;using System.IO;namespace Pmars{ class JingDong { //得到京东页面的编码格式 static Encoding encoding = Encoding.GetEncoding("gb23 阅读全文
posted @ 2011-12-30 12:54 枫- 阅读(1625) 评论(1) 推荐(0)
摘要:usingSystem;usingSystem.Collections.Generic;usingSystem.Text;usingSystem.Collections;usingSystem.Drawing;usingSystem.Drawing.Imaging;usingSystem.Runtime.InteropServices;namespaceBallotAiying2{classUnCodebase{publicBitmapbmpobj;publicUnCodebase(Bitmappic){bmpobj=newBitmap(pic);//转换为Format32bppRgb}/// 阅读全文
posted @ 2011-12-30 11:49 枫- 阅读(457) 评论(0) 推荐(0)
摘要:页面缓存使用OutputCache指令。<%@ OutputCache Duration="3600" Location="Any" VaryByCustom="browser" VaryByParam="RequestID" %>其中Duration和VaryByParam特性是必须的。Location控制页面缓存的位置Location含义Any默认值。意味着页面的输出可以缓存在客户端浏览器,缓存在任何“下游”的客户端(如代理服务器),或缓存在Web服务器本身Client指明输出缓存只能存储在发出请求 阅读全文
posted @ 2011-12-14 15:31 枫- 阅读(409) 评论(0) 推荐(0)
摘要:今天我来谈一谈容易被人混淆的二个集合:Request[]与Request.Params[]这二个集合我在博客【我心目中的Asp.net核心对象】中就提到过它们, 而且还给出了一个示例,并以截图的形式揭示过它们的差别。但由于那篇博客中有更多有价值的对象要介绍, 因此也就没有花太多的篇幅着重介绍这二个集合。但我发现,不知道这二个集合差别的人确实太多,以至于我认为很有必要为它们写个专题来细说它们的差别了。在ASP.NET编程中,有三个比较常见的来自于客户端的数据来源:QueryString, Form, Cookie 。 我们可以在HttpRequest中访问这三大对象, 比如,可以从QuerySt 阅读全文
posted @ 2011-12-09 09:38 枫- 阅读(229) 评论(0) 推荐(0)
摘要:在Asp.Net里使用动态缓存文件Posted on 2007-04-18 09:14 faib 阅读(813) 评论(2) 编辑 收藏 在Asp.Net里,可以使用CacheDependency可以在程序里自动的创建一个缓存文件,比如验证码控件中,图片文件就是动态的添加的。 建立缓存文件信息的类:1publicclassFileCacheInfo2{3privatestringm_FileName;4privatestringm_ContentType;5privateobjectm_Content;6privateDateTimem_DateEntered=DateTime.Now;... 阅读全文
posted @ 2011-11-29 17:20 枫- 阅读(382) 评论(0) 推荐(0)
摘要:List<Plan> Plans = new List<Plan>();//存放服务器中的当前用户所接受的项目计划列表。//Plan 类包含PlanID等属性。if (Plans.Contains<Plan>(changedPlan, Comparers.Default)){}//判断Plans中是否存在与changedPlan相同的Plan。//(只需判断其PlanID是否相同即可。其他内容可忽略)// Comparers.Default为自定义比较器。public class Comparers : IEqualityComparer<Plan&g 阅读全文
posted @ 2011-11-10 10:10 枫- 阅读(745) 评论(0) 推荐(0)
摘要:通过Server.Transfer 方法把执行流程从当前的ASPX 文件转到同一服务器上的另一个ASPX 页面的同时,可保留表单数据或查询字符串,做法是把该方法的第二个参数设置成True,在第一个页面用Server.Transfer("目标页面名。 aspx",true);目标页面取出数据用:Ruquest.Form["控件名称"]或Ruquest.QueryString["控件名称"]。 Asp.net2.0 中还可以这样来用,代码如下:PReviousPage pg1;pg1=(PreviousPage)Context.Handl 阅读全文
posted @ 2011-11-05 21:30 枫- 阅读(251) 评论(0) 推荐(0)
摘要://首先要在PageLoad()事件中注册属性 protected void Page_Load(object sender, EventArgs e) { if (!IsPostBack) { Button1.Attributes.Add("onclick", "return checkSame()");//为Button1添加onclick()事件 ,Button为服务器控件 }//注意:checkSame()这是一个写在aspx面页的js函数,必须有返回值,为:true 或 false }//接着写Button1的onclick事件,如果刚才的ch 阅读全文
posted @ 2011-10-12 11:05 枫- 阅读(267) 评论(0) 推荐(0)
摘要:1、Guid.NewGuid().ToString("N") 结果为: 38bddf48f43c48588e0d78761eaa1ce62、Guid.NewGuid().ToString("D") 结果为: 57d99d89-caab-482a-a0e9-a0a803eed3ba3、Guid.NewGuid().ToString("B") 结果为: {09f140d5-af72-44ba-a763-c861304b46f8}4、Guid.NewGuid().ToString("P") 结果为: (778406c2- 阅读全文
posted @ 2011-10-12 09:55 枫- 阅读(283) 评论(0) 推荐(0)
摘要:const string sUserAgent = "Mozilla/4.0 (compatible; MSIE 7.0; Windows NT 5.2; .NET CLR 1.1.4322; .NET CLR 2.0.50727)"; const string sContentType = "application/x-www-form-urlencoded"; const string sRequestEncoding = "utf-8"; const string sResponseEncoding = "utf-8& 阅读全文
posted @ 2011-06-17 14:12 枫- 阅读(1086) 评论(0) 推荐(1)